Application of bionano optical mapping for the diagnosis of a 16p11.2-p12.2 microdeletion

OBJECTIVE: To delineate chromosomal aberration caused by structural chromosomal abnormalities with bionano optical mapping.

METHODS: Chromosomal karyotyping, bionano optical mapping and copy number variation sequencing (CNV-seq) were used to delineate the chromosomal aberration carried by a patient.

RESULTS: The patient was found to have an anomalous chromosome 16 by karyotyping analysis, which was verified by bionano optical mapping and CNV-seq as loss of heterozygosity at 16p11.2-p12.2.

CONCLUSION: Bionano optical mapping has provided a novel tool for the detection and diagnosis of structural chromosomal aberrations.
